How much do autocad eng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 3, 2026, the average yearly pay for autocad engineer in the United States is $101,752.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$84,000.00 and $116,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an AutoCAD engineer do?

An AutoCAD engineer uses AutoCAD software to create detailed technical drawings and plans for construction, manufacturing, or engineering projects. They interpret specifications, ensure accuracy, and often collaborate with architects, engineers, and project managers to develop design solutions. Proficiency in CAD tools and understanding of engineering principles are essential for this role.

What are the typical responsibilities of an AutoCAD Engineer on a day-to-day basis?

As an AutoCAD Engineer, your daily responsibilities often include developing and modifying technical drawings, working from project specifications or sketches provided by engineers or architects. You may also be tasked with coordinating with project managers and other team members to ensure that designs meet required standards and timelines. Quality-checking your own work, updating documents as project changes occur, and sometimes conducting site visits to verify measurements or gather information are common. Collaboration is key, as you’ll frequently share your designs with engineering teams, construction staff, or clients for review and feedback.

AutoCAD Technician

KEITH is seeking an AutoCAD Technician in our Pompano Beach, FL office. We are looking for positive individuals to fit our energetic culture. We are a well-established multidisciplinary company that offers civil engineering, land surveying, subsurface utility engineering, planning, landscape architecture, and construction management services. The firm was founded on the principle of achieving success by combining the latest technology with client-oriented business practices and a strong group of talented professionals.

Responsibilities:

  • Assist in the preparation and updating of engineering drawings using AutoCAD and Civil 3D.
  • Support design staff with drafting tasks for civil engineering, land development, utility, and infrastructure projects.
  • Make revisions to drawings based on redlines and feedback from engineers and project managers.
  • Assist with organizing and maintaining electronic project files and CAD libraries.
  • Help incorporate field data, sketches, and markups into CAD drawings under supervision.
  • Provide general drafting support to engineering and design teams as needed.
  • Learn and apply company CAD standards and drafting best practices through on-the-job training.

Qualifications:

  • Basic knowledge of AutoCAD is required.
  • Exposure to AutoCAD Civil 3D is required; willingness to learn and improve skills is essential.
  • Bentley MicroStation and OpenRoads experience is a plus, but not required.
  • Strong interest in civil engineering drafting and design.
  • Ability to read and interpret basic engineering sketches and markups.
  • Basic PC skills and familiarity with Microsoft Office and CAD software.
  • Strong attention to detail and willingness to learn.
  • Good communication skills and a positive attitude in a team environment.
  • Ability to take direction, ask questions, and manage assigned tasks.
  • Associate degree or technical certification in CAD Drafting, Engineering Technology, or related field preferred, but not required.
  • Internship, coursework, or limited professional experience in CAD is a plus.
